Metal and Plastic Recycling: Contribution to Nature and Economy
Recycling is of great importance in terms of protecting limited natural resources, saving energy and reducing the amount of waste. In this process, metal and plastic recycling attracts attention with its benefits to nature and economic returns.
Metal Recycling
Metals are among the materials with the highest recyclability rate. Metals can be processed again and again into new products.
Energy Saving: Metal recycling uses 95% less energy than producing new metal.
Raw Material Conservation: By recycling, the amount of minerals extracted is reduced and natural resources are protected.
Economic Value: The sale of scrap metals contributes to recycling economically.
Plastic Recycling
Plastic recycling plays a critical role in reducing environmental pollution. While plastics take a long time to decompose in nature, the recycling process brings this waste into the economy.
Energy Efficiency: Less energy is consumed during recycling and savings of up to 80% can be achieved compared to the production of new plastic.
Waste Reduction: Plastic waste is prevented from accumulating in nature, and land and marine ecosystems are protected.
Reuse: Reprocessing of plastics allows the production of new packaging and products.
